分享

马泥轰: 欧奈尔RPS曲线

 lm7812 2019-04-17

1. 欧奈尔RPS定义

欧奈尔定义的股价相对强度RPS该指数介于1至99之间指在过去一年全部股票的涨幅排行榜中前1%的股票的RPS为99前2%的股票的RPS为98依次类推

2. 欧奈尔的RPS曲线的编制方法

2.1. 计算股票涨跌幅公式RPS250

2.1.1. 计算一年期股价涨跌幅

N:=250;

RPS-N:IF(FINANCE(42)>365,(C-REF(C,N))/REF(C,N),DRAWNULL);

{输出RPS:如果上市的天数>365,返回(收盘价-N日前的收盘价)/N日前的收盘价,否则返回无效数}

建立公式计算N日内股票涨跌幅大家根据需要设置N的数值N缺省值为250

图1

2.2. 对股票涨跌幅进行排序-使用扩展数据

2.2.1. 设置数据1对应250日的RPS

通达信软件输入.902进入扩展数据管理器

图2

2.2.1.1. 扩展数据管理器

图3

2.2.1.2. 修改数据1的属性

在扩展数据属性里首先设置数据1如下

指标选择新建的RPS250指标

计算时段为本地所有数据

数据名称为RPS250

计算品种为沪深A股

勾选精确复权生成横向排名

排名方法为0-1000归一化顺序

图4

2.2.1. 设置数据N对应N天RPS

如果需要设置半年期50天等RPS曲线再重复上述步骤在扩展数据属性里设置对应数据N计算参数为N对应N天的RPS

2.3. 将排序结果显示为曲线-即RPS股价相对强度

将排序结果显示为曲线计算RPS股价相对强度

2.3.1. 公式代码

股价相对强度RPS的代码如下

M:=90;

87;

Y:=EXTDATA_USER(1,0);{250天的}

RPS250:Y/10,LINETHICK1,COLORRED;

IF(RPS250>=M,RPS250,DRAWNULL),LINETHICK3,COLORRED;

图5

2.3.2. 确保下载完整的历史数据

2.3.2.1. 切记1下载完整的历史数据这个只需要操作一次

通达信软件的菜单—系统—盘后数据下载请自行修改下载的开始时间

图6

2.3.2.2. 切记2每天存盘下载日线数据并全部刷新两条扩展数据

需要每天存盘下载日线数据并刷新扩展数据这个操作每天收盘后都需要进行一次才能显示最新的RPS曲线

图7

3. 调用RPS曲线

上面的步骤都完成后在K线界面输入RPS即可看到RPS曲线了每次记得先刷新RPS250再进行选股

一般我们说的RPS>90指的是一年线当曲线数值超过90时会由细红线自动变成2倍粗红线一目了然

图8

4. 注意的问题

4.1. 增加RPS曲线

后期增加其他RPS曲线时先在RPS曲线公式里添加相应公式源码再新建一个对应的RPS涨跌幅公式然后设置扩展数据最后刷新即可

4.2. 使用RPS选股

1本文的设置方法不需要建立上市一年板块公式已经直接过滤每次刷新RPS数据时会自动更新

2使用公式中含有RPS的条件选股时需要将当天的RPS数据进行刷新再选股否则会出现一个股票也选不出的情况

3如有其他问题请留言详细描述问题

感谢陶博士和分享文中方法的朋友

祝账户市值一路向北

    本站是提供个人知识管理的网络存储空间,所有内容均由用户发布,不代表本站观点。请注意甄别内容中的联系方式、诱导购买等信息,谨防诈骗。如发现有害或侵权内容,请点击一键举报。
    转藏 分享 献花(0

    0条评论

    发表

    请遵守用户 评论公约

    类似文章 更多